Disable power management features to maximize power usage
31 January 2001 by Snakefoot | Comment » | Trackback OffThe Power Management Features in Windows 9x are not completely bug free, and many times they can introduce system instability or erratic cpu usage.
It is a generally good idea to disable power management features especially if using an ACPI compatible computer.

It is a generally good idea to disable power management features especially if using an ACPI compatible computer.
- Press Start -> Settings -> Control Panel -> System-Device Manager and expand System devices
- Right click Advanced Power Management support and select Properties
- Toggle Disable in this hardware profile for the device
